Step into early 20th-century Reading with this divided back postcard showing North 5th Street looking north from Oley Street, a quiet residential stretch lined with ornate Queen Anne and late Victorian homes.
Architectural highlights include turrets, gables, bay windows, and wraparound porches, all framed by mature trees and a bright sky. The vantage point begins at Oley Street, named for the historic Oley Valley, a cradle of Berks County settlement and German heritage.
This tranquil scene reflects the elegance of Reading’s Centre Park Historic District and its turn-of-the-century affluence. A must-have for collectors of Pennsylvania architecture, Berks County history, or vintage street views.
